Tomo Matsumoto (マツモト トモ, Matsumoto Tomo, born January 8 in Osaka Prefecture) is a Japanese manga artist. She made her professional debut with the short story Nemuri Hime (眠る姫, "Sleeping Princess"), published in the March 10, 1995 issue of Hakusensha's Lunatic LaLa magazine.[1][2] Prior to becoming a manga artist, Matsumoto was a nurse.[2]
